Go to HomepageReel Number: 220742-04
Color: Black and White
Sound: SIL
Year / Date: 1918
Country: France
Location: Alsace,Lorraine,Paris
TC Begins: 01:44:44
TC Ends: 01:56:25
Duration: 00:11:41
WWI - Celebrations in Paris - Liberation of Alsace-Lorraine Flags flying on top of building w/ spectators & cameramen looking over edge. Massive crowd below. Obelisk w/ biplane flying past & circling. Paris citizens celebrate the return of Alsace-Lorraine to French rule. Civilian men marching thru crowd; tank parked. 01:45:45 French soldier w/ big mustache, American flag & bugle walks towards camera in middle of Champs Elysees waving American flag & bugle. Planes flying over Concorde monument. 01:46:06 VIPs arriving for ceremony, shaking hands. Upholstered chairs. President Poincaré addresses the crowd. Many pigeons or doves released. 01:47:45 Crowds in wide avenue. Crowds including women in traditional Alsace costume in Champs Elysees. Crowds w/ flags including American Stars and Stripes. Very large parade of both civilians & military from Allied nations, also Red Cross nurses. Many banners; marching unites w/ military caps. Some wreaths. Flag of Ireland; Canada military units. High angle of crowd. Large English flag. New Zealand flag & troops; Australian. South Africa. (Card says reviewed by Premier Clémenceau & Marshal Joffre) 01:55:58 The crowds dismantle a captured German airplane. Celebration; Post-WWI; WW1
